In 1927, Fred Hayes started the bottle and sack merchant business that would become Hayes Metals, Australasia’s largest metal ingot producer and leading scrap metal recycler. After almost a hundred years, the company is still owned by descendants of the Hayes family, with four successive generations involved in the business. We are New Zealand's oldest Metal Recycling company.
Fred Hayes founded his recycling business in Newmarket, Auckland, initially concentrating on the collection and reuse of glass bottles and packing materials. This laid the foundation for a strong recycling culture within the company.
Over time, the business expanded into the metals industry, which remains its primary focus today.

After more than 80 years in Newmarket, Hayes Metals relocated its production to a larger five-acre facility in Onehunga, Auckland. This move was driven by the need for expanded space to accommodate growing operations and enhance production capabilities. The new facility represented a significant upgrade, allowing Hayes Metals to better serve its customers and continue its legacy of excellence in the metal industry.
The old metal refinery on Teed Street, Newmarket, was converted into a high-end retail precinct called 'The Foundry', with 14 new stores that would add another layer of boutique retail to the area. The precinct still retains the foundry’s gritty heritage and boasts local and international brands.

In 2016, Hayes Metals acquired the assets of Sims Metal Management's foundry division. This acquisition allowed Hayes Metals to further expand its capabilities and enhance its service offerings at its Auckland site.
In 2018, Hayes Metals established an office in Thailand. This expansion into Southeast Asia marked a significant milestone, enabling the company to better serve its international clients and tap into new markets within the region.
In 2023, Hayes Metals Pty Ltd established an office in Dandenong (VIC). This expansion further strengthened the company's presence in the Australian market and improved the ability to serve its customers in Victoria and enhance its operational capabilities in the region.
In 2024, Hayes Metals Pty Ltd acquired Northern Smelters in Queensland. This acquisition further expanded the company's capabilities and product range, reinforcing its commitment to growth and excellence in the metal recycling industry.
After almost 100 years in business, Hayes Metals continues to expand with the establishment of Hayes Recycling in Western Australia, a specialist and innovative oil and gas infrastructure recycling plant.
